Understanding the Rising Concerns Around Funeral Troubles
In a landscape where funerals are deeply personal and often distressing occasions, a recent survey by Delight Inc. has illuminated a pressing issue: an increasing number of people are facing troubles related to funerals, predominantly revolving around costs and estimates. Conducted among 78 individuals aged between their 20s and 70s, this survey highlights the critical nature of transparent communication in the funeral industry.
Overview of the Study
Delight Inc., headquartered in Shinjuku, Tokyo, unveiled the findings of this survey on April 20, 2026. As the number of inquiries regarding funeral services reached an all-time high of 978 in 2024 at the National Consumer Affairs Center of Japan, the need for real-life examples of funeral-related troubles became evident. Despite rising concerns, concrete cases that consumers could learn from remain scarce, making it difficult for individuals to prepare adequately. This survey aims to bridge that gap.
Key Findings
The results of the survey categorized the reported troubles into eight distinct areas, shedding light on where most issues arise.
1.
Funeral Costs and Estimates: 22 reported cases (28% of total)
2.
Insufficient Explanations/ Misunderstandings: 20 cases
3.
Staff Interaction and Service Quality: 14 reports
4.
Religious Personnel and Offering Issues: 6 cases
5.
Venue and Crematorium Problems: 5 instances
6.
Transportation Issues: 5 cases
7.
Scheduling and Process Issues: 4 incidences
8.
Inheritance and Family Disputes: 2 cases
The most prevalent issue identified was linked to funeral costs and estimates, with significant discrepancies noted by those surveyed, such as being charged far beyond initial quotes and encountering unexpected additional fees. These financial misunderstandings underscore the need for clearer communication from service providers.
Next in line were problems stemming from insufficient explanations or misunderstandings, which, when combined with cost-related issues, highlighted that over half of the reported troubles could stem from lapses in communication.
Preventable Issues
Significantly, many of the 78 cases gathered during the survey suggested that proactive measures could have mitigated these issues. Recognizing potential problems ahead of time often provides families with the foresight to make informed decisions. Encouraging families to engage in discussions about funeral planning ahead of time, and to utilize resources such as cost comparisons, can lead to a reduction in misunderstandings and disputes.
The data revealed that many people felt ill-prepared or lacked vital information about the funeral process, which can be exacerbated by emotional stress during a loved one's passing. Proper research on service providers, reviews, costs, and previous client experiences could assist families in choosing the right funeral services without running into future conflicts.
